The Rise of 3x3 Basketball in Argentina

Let's talk about the rise of 3x3 basketball in Argentina. It's not just a game; it's a cultural phenomenon that's been sweeping the nation. Over the past decade, 3x3 has exploded in popularity, driven by its accessibility, fast-paced nature, and the sheer thrill it offers both players and spectators. You see, unlike traditional basketball, 3x3 requires fewer players and less space, making it perfect for urban environments. Parks, plazas, and even parking lots transform into makeshift courts where players can showcase their skills and passion for the game. The simplicity of the rules—one basket, twelve seconds on the shot clock, and a smaller court—creates an intense and dynamic playing experience. Plus, the energetic atmosphere, often accompanied by music and street art, adds to the overall appeal. What's really cool is how the Argentine Basketball Federation has recognized and supported the growth of 3x3, organizing tournaments and providing resources to help develop talent. This support has been crucial in elevating the level of play and attracting more participants. It's become a fantastic avenue for young athletes to gain exposure and hone their skills. Many have even used 3x3 as a stepping stone to bigger opportunities in traditional basketball. Key Tournaments and Events

Now, let’s get into the key 3x3 tournaments and events in Argentina that you absolutely need to know about! These events are where the magic happens, showcasing top talent and bringing communities together. One of the most prominent is the Argentine 3x3 Circuit, organized by the Argentine Basketball Federation. This nationwide tournament features multiple stages held in different cities, attracting teams from all corners of the country. It's a fantastic platform for players to compete at a high level and earn ranking points that can qualify them for international competitions. The atmosphere at these events is electric, with fans packing the sidelines to cheer on their favorite teams. Beyond the official circuit, you'll find numerous local and regional tournaments popping up throughout the year. These grassroots events are often organized by community groups or local basketball clubs and provide an opportunity for players of all skill levels to get involved. They're a great way to experience the camaraderie and passion that defines the Argentine 3x3 scene. The Rules and Regulations

Let's break down the rules and regulations that govern the fast-paced world of 3x3 basketball in Argentina. Understanding these rules is key, whether you're a player looking to compete or a fan wanting to follow the game more closely. 3x3 basketball is played on a half-court with one basket. Each team consists of three players and one substitute. Games typically last for 10 minutes, or until one team reaches 21 points. One of the key differences from traditional basketball is the shot clock, which is limited to 12 seconds. This forces teams to make quick decisions and keeps the game moving at a rapid pace. Scoring is also slightly different, with shots inside the arc worth one point and shots outside the arc worth two points. A successful free throw is worth one point. After each successful basket, the ball is not cleared back beyond the arc as in traditional basketball. Instead, after a successful basket or free throw, play restarts with a player from the non-scoring team dribbling or passing the ball from inside the arc to any place outside the arc. This keeps the game flowing and emphasizes quick transitions. Fouls are another important aspect of the game. Personal fouls are recorded, and once a team accumulates six team fouls, the opposing team is awarded free throws. Technical and unsportsmanlike fouls can also result in free throws or possession of the ball. The official rulebook of FIBA (International Basketball Federation) governs most 3x3 tournaments and events in Argentina. However, some local or regional tournaments may have slight variations in the rules, so it's always a good idea to check with the organizers beforehand.
